Cysteine, ethyl ester, hydrochloride (1:1)

Description:
Cysteine, ethyl ester, hydrochloride (1:1) is a derivative of the amino acid cysteine, characterized by the presence of an ethyl ester group and a hydrochloride salt form. This compound typically appears as a white to off-white crystalline powder, which is soluble in water due to the hydrochloride component. It is known for its role in biochemical applications, particularly in the synthesis of peptides and proteins, as well as in various research contexts involving thiol chemistry. The ethyl ester modification enhances its lipophilicity, potentially improving its absorption and bioavailability in biological systems. Cysteine itself is a sulfur-containing amino acid that plays a crucial role in protein structure and function, particularly in the formation of disulfide bonds. As a hydrochloride salt, this compound is often used in laboratory settings and may have applications in pharmaceuticals, particularly in formulations requiring stable amino acid derivatives. Safety data should be consulted for handling and usage, as with all chemical substances.
